About the author

Dr Jerry Mofokeng
On 28 June 2019, Dr Jerry Mofokeng wa Makhetha received an honorary Doctor of Letters (DLitt) degree from the University of the Free State (UFS) for his commitment to scholarship and his service to humanity.

Dr Makhetha is an iconic and award-winning South African actor who has appeared in several critically acclaimed films, including Cry, the Beloved Country; Lord of War; Mandela and de Klerk; and the 2005 Academy Award-winning film Tsotsi.  Dr Mofokeng studied at Wits Drama School where he initially majored in Acting, and later went on to study at Columbia University in America, where he obtained his master's degree in Theatre Directing.



About the book:
Dr Jerry Mofokeng wa Makhetha always felt like an outsider in his family. At the age of 58, he discovers who his real father is. Suddenly his search for identity makes sense. He gives us a glimpse into his family life – his love for his wife and kids, as well as tracing the highlights and disappointments of his career. Along the way, he learns some very important lessons about manhood. This is a memoir, but also a challenge to South African men to live out their masculinity in a responsible way.

Prof. Strauss' book is launched
2010-08-18

 
At the launch were, from the left: Prof. Francois Tolmie, Dean of the Faculty of Theology at the UFS; Prof. Pieter Strauss; and Wikus van Zyl, Manager: SUN MeDIA Bloemfontein.

Kerk en orde vandag: Met die klem op die NG Kerk was recently launched at a function in the Faculty of Theology at the University of the Free State (UFS). Prof. Pieter Strauss, Head of the Department of Church History and Polity at the UFS is the author of this book that is published by SUN MeDIA Bloemfontein.

The objective of the book is to provide the reader with an introductory view on the reformed church law. Therefore it concentrates on themes that are spread across the entire spectrum of the reformed church law.

The book endeavours to provide relevant background information for all the articles of the Church Order of the Dutch Reformed Church, but is not exhaustive in this regard. Prof. Strauss refrained from only writing about existing articles as positivist church law on purpose. He wanted to make more of the background, introductory questions and particularly a normative church law.

According to Prof. Andries le Roux du Plooy from the Faculty of Theology at the North-West University, Prof. Strauss gave evidence that he was experienced and excellently informed about all the themes and topics, had personal experience thereof, and that he could write critically and apologetically about it.

“I want to congratulate Prof. Strauss on the publication. To my mind, there are few other theologians that will be able to write about the topic in such a way with emphasis on the DR Church,” said Prof. Du Plooy.
